Rep. Tom McClintock (CA-04) recently held a town hall that drew a full-to-capacity crowd, with 200 more constituents outside the theater’s door. Rep. McClintock defended the Republican-led agenda and the overflow crowd was not happy. Rep. McClintock fled the theater to chants of “Shame on you!” Police helped him to a waiting SUV that rapidly sped away from the crowd.
Rep. McClintock has repeatedly told anyone who’ll listen that there “was a threat of violence and police had to intervene in the end.” With zero arrests that day, Roseville Chief of Police Daniel Hahn is batting down any notion the protesters were violent or threatening:
Was the gathering loud? “Yes,” Hahn said.
Was it the biggest protest Hahn has seen in nearly six years as the Roseville chief? “Yes,” Hahn said. “But things went very well that day. They went as well as could be expected. … The people gathered weren’t causing problems.”
Because of the size of the overflow crowd outside the theater, Chief Hahn said they made the decision to escort McClintock to get to the waiting vehicle, but they did not shut down the event:
The chief added that it was his call, in consultation with his staff, for officers to escort McClintock out of the theater and to his car. “We took some precautionary measures for the safety of everyone involved,” he said.
But here’s an important point: McClintock’s meeting was not “disrupted.”
“The plan was for the meeting to end at 11, and it did,” Hahn said. “We did not have discussions with McClintock’s staff to have a second session. It was our decision to escort him out, but it was not our decision to bring the event to a close.”
There is a video of the “threatening” constituents singing Woody Guthrie’s “This Land is Your Land” and chanting “Send him out!”

In fairness, under parliamentary systems the Prime Minister assembles his or her cabinet from the relatively small pool of active legislators from (typically but not always) the PM’s party, making the selection process a lot simpler. The separation between executive and legislative functions is far less stark.
